The Louisville Free Public Library needs our help

August 7, 2009 · Posted in Chit Chat 

On Tuesday the Louisville Free Public Library was hit by a flash flood caused by a storm that dropped 7  inches of rain in 75 minutes.  Damages are estimated at $5 million, their servers, bookmobiles, offices, processing room and more were covered by 6 feet of water.
